EAC’s of Assessment Statistics

EAC Visual Data is the reporting tool for Blackboard's Assessment and Accreditation solution that seamlessly integrates into Learn Ultra to provide visualizations and robust analytics on rubric and test reliability. Some of the key functionality that EAC can provide includes individual student performance data on each row of a rubric's criteria and the overall reliability of a course's rubrics and tests for evaluating students.

Print a Course Rubric Using EAC Visual Data

EAC Visual Data allows instructors to download and print rubrics used in their Learn Ultra courses for easier review, sharing, or record keeping. Rubrics can be exported as PDFs or Excel files, making it simple to view the full set of criteria, scores, and performance levels outside of Blackboard.

Run a Rubric Report in EAC

The EAC Rubric Report provides a detailed view of student performance on rubric-based assessments. You can explore results by overall scores, individual criteria, and grading patterns, and export the data for reporting or further analysis.

Run an EAC Goal Report

The EAC Goals Report provides an interactive way to view and explore student performance on selected learning goals. You can filter results by course, assessment, student, or term, and customize how achievement levels are displayed. The report can also be downloaded for further analysis or reporting.

Using EAC’s Goal Manager for Rubric and Exam Alignments

The EAC Visual Data tool has a Goals Manager area that allows instructors and assessment teams to view the existing alignment of goals to rubric rows or individual questions and to Edit, Add, or Remove alignments to rubric rows or individual questions. Since goal alignments are typically reserved for accreditation purposes, please contact your Department coordinator/chair before making any Goal Alignments.
